Castform Eventually on Route 6, I found Castform. Castform has 4 different forms, depending on the weather. Standard form is Normal Type. Sunny form is Fire Type, activated by Harsh Sunlight. Rainy Form is Water Type, activated by Rain. Snowy Form is Ice Type, activated by Hail. Once I found it, I made my way to a healing house which was just positioned outside of Chargestone Cave.
